閱讀屋>職場> 會計從業會計證輔導:會計電算化常用術語二

會計從業會計證輔導:會計電算化常用術語二

會計從業會計證輔導:會計電算化常用術語(二)

為剛接觸會計電算化的朋友提供一些常用的電算化術語,續接會計從業會計證輔導:會計電算化常用術語(一),總共有四篇

方法/步驟

1

軟體開發方法

軟體開發是一項複雜的系統工程。60年代爆發了軟體危機,促使人們探討科學的軟體開發方法,經過長期的開發實踐,提出了許多軟體開發方法,其中主要有生命週期法、原型法和麵向物件法等。

(1)生命週期法。軟體開發嚴格按系統調查與分析、系統設計、系統實現、系統除錯、執行維護和廢棄等階段進行。這種方法要求系統說明書應準確地表達使用者的要求,並且在以後階段不會發生變化。

生命週期法採用結構化系統分析與設計的思想,其突出優點是強調系統開發過程的整體性和全域性性,避免了開發過程中的混亂狀態。其主要缺陷是開發週期長,工作效率低,難以適應新型開發工具的發展,但其基本思想在其他開發方法仍然適用。

(2)原型法。開發人員首先構造系統初步模型,執行這個模型並根據使用者的要求不斷修改、補充,直到取得一個使用者完全滿意的原型為止,最後實現系統。

原型法的主要優點是開發週期短、見效快,可以邊開發邊使用,比較適合於管理體制和結構不穩定,需要經常變化的環境。其缺點是初始原型設計比較困難,容易陷入軟體危機,對於大型複雜的應用系統一般不宜採用。

(3)面向物件法。簡稱OO,其基本思想是:客觀事物都是由物件組成的,物件具有屬性和方法,屬性反映物件的特徵,方法則是改變屬性的各種動作;物件之間的聯絡主要透過傳遞訊息來實現;物件可以按屬性歸為類,類有一定的結構,而且可以有子類,物件與類之間的層次關係是透過繼承來維持的。

按照上述思想,OO方法分為四個階段:系統調查和需求分析,解決系統幹什麼;面向物件分析,識別出物件及其行為、結構、屬性和方法,簡稱OOA;面向物件設計,對分析結果進一步抽象、歸類和整理,最終以正規化的形式確定下來,簡稱OOD;面向物件程式設計,利用面向物件程式設計語言編制應用程式,簡稱OOP. OO方法解決了傳統的結構化開發方法中的許多缺陷,縮短了開發週期,是軟體開發技術的一次重大革命。但同原型法一樣,需要有一定的軟體支援工具才能應用。

2

VisualBasic

美國Microsoft公司於1991年研製的一種基於圖形使用者介面的Windows環境下的開發工具,是一種面向物件、視覺化的新型開發工具,可在包括Windows98和WindowsNT在內的所有Windows環境下執行。

VisualBasic利用其事件驅動的程式設計機制和新穎易用的視覺化設計工具,並使用Windows內部應用程式介面函式,採用動態連結庫(DLL)、動態資料交換(DDE)、物件的連結與嵌入(OLE)以及開放式資料庫訪問(ODBC)等技術,可以高效、快速地創建出Windows環境下功能強大並且具有圖形介面豐富的應用軟體系統。

VisualBasic中提供開放式資料庫訪問功能,可透過直接訪問或建立連線的方式使用並操作外部資料庫。VisualBasic系統本身提供了非常好的資料管理功能,利用資料管理器(DataManager),使用者可以直接建立Access資料庫,還可以直接編輯和訪問其他外部資料庫,如FoxPro、dBASE和FoxBASE等。透過視窗設計器,可以建立資料訪問窗體。

在表格的處理方面,VisualBasic捆綁了Crystalreport,基本上可以滿足表格處理所需的功能。VisualBasic既適合於應用軟體的開發,也可用於開發系統軟體。

3

PowerBuilder

美國Sybase公司研製的一種新型、快速開發工具,是客戶機/伺服器結構下,基於Windows3.x、Windows95和WindowsNT的一個整合化開發工具。它包含一個直觀的圖形介面和可擴充套件的面向物件的程式語言PowerScript,提供與當前流行的大型資料庫的介面,並透過ODBC與單機資料庫相連。其主要特點如下:

(1)視覺化、多特性的開發工具。全面支援Windows或WindowsNT所提供的控制、事件和函式。PowerScript語言提供了幾百個內部函式,並且具有一個面向物件的編譯器和偵錯程式,可以隨時編譯新增加的程式碼,帶有完整的線上幫助和程式設計例項。

(2)功能強大的面向物件技術。支援透過對類的定義來建立可視或不可視物件模型,同時支援所有面向物件程式設計技術,如繼承、資料封裝和函式多型性等。這些特性確保了應用程式的可靠性,提高了軟體的可維護性。

(3)支援高效的複雜應用程式。對基於Windows環境的應用程式提供了完備的支援,這些環境包括Windows、WindowsNT和WinOS/2.開發人員可以使用PowerBuilder內建的WatcomC/C++來定義、編譯和除錯一個類。

(4)企業資料庫的連線能力。PowerBuilder的主要特色是DataWindow(資料視窗),透過DataWindow可以方便地對資料庫進行各種操作,也可以處理各種報表,而無需編寫SQL語句,可以直接與Sybase、SQLServer、Informix、Oracle等大型資料庫連線。

(5)強大的查詢、報表和圖形功能。PowerBuilder提供的`視覺化查詢生成器和多個表的快速選擇器可以建立查詢物件,並把查詢結果作為各種報表的資料來源。PowerBuilder主要適用於管理資訊系統的開發,特別是客戶機/伺服器結構。

4

Delphi

Delphi是Borland公司研製的新一代視覺化開發工具,可在Windows3.x、Windows95、WindowsNT等環境下使用。它擁有一個視覺化的整合開發環境(IDE),採用面向物件的程式語言ObjectPascal和基於部件的開發結構框架。Delphi它提供了100多個可供使用的構件,利用這些部件,開發人員可以快速地構造出應用低場?⑷嗽幣部梢願葑約旱男枰薷牟考蠐elphi本身編寫自己的部件。主要特點如下:

(1)直接編譯生成可執行程式碼,編譯速度快。由於Delphi編譯器採用了條件編譯和選擇連結技術,使用它生成的執行檔案更加精煉,執行速度更快。在處理速度和存取伺服器方面,Delphi的效能遠遠高於其他同類產品。

(2)支援將存取規則分別交給客戶機或伺服器處理的兩種方案,而且允許開發人員建立一個簡單的部件或部件集合,封裝起所有的規則,並獨立於伺服器和客戶機,所有的資料轉移透過這些部件來完成。這樣,大大減少了對伺服器的請求和網路上的資料傳輸量,提高了應用處理的速度。

(3)提供了許多快速方便的開發方法,使開發人員能用盡可能少的重複性工作完成各種不同的應用。利用專案模板和專家生成器可以很快建立專案的構架,然後根據使用者的實際需要逐步完善。

(4)具有可重用性和可擴充套件性。開發人員不必再對諸如標籤、按鈕及對話方塊等Windows的常見部件進行程式設計。Delphi包含許多可以重複使用的部件,允許使用者控制Windows的開發效果。

(5)具有強大的資料存取功能。它的資料處理工具BDE(BorlandDatabaseEngine)是一個標準的中介軟體層,可以用來處理當前流行的資料格式,如xBase、Paradox等,也可以透過BDE的SQLLink直接與Sybase、SQLServer、Informix、Oracle等大型資料庫連線。Delphi既可用於開發系統軟體,也適合於應用軟體的開發。

5

OrcaleDeveloper2000

美國Orcale公司1995年推出的一種新型開發工具。Developer2000支援跨平臺應用程式的開發,可用於Macintosh和Unix等平臺。它提供了一種面向物件的開發環境,這一環境將強有力的預設性質、說明性的非過程方法以及易用重用的應用成分組合成一個整體。預設性質能確保對開發過程的快速啟動,說明性方法將預設特性擴充套件到那些需要廣泛予以重用的功能上。

Developer2000設計環境針對提高開發人員的生產效率做了最佳化,無論是建立一個螢幕、一個選單、一份報表或一個圖形模組,這些工具都使用同一設計介面,該介面包括以下關鍵部分:

(1)物件導航器,為應用提供一種結構化的表示。

(2)屬性調配器,使開發人員能夠對當前所選擇的一組物件的一類屬性作檢查和修改。

(3)Oracle過程建立程式,是為PL/SQL進行編輯、解釋和排錯的環境。因此,Developer2000工具集提供了一組統一的客戶/伺服器編輯程式,以實現將應用邏輯分解在伺服器和客戶機之間。開發人員很容易掌握該工具集的使用,而且能夠權衡和調整客戶/伺服器的應用。

(4)所見即所得式的佈局編輯程式。Developer2000的所有工具均使用同一個所見即所得式的圖形編輯程式,包括螢幕、報表和圖形物件。Developer2000主要適用於應用軟體的開發。


[會計從業會計證輔導:會計電算化常用術語(二)]相關文章:

1.會計從業會計證輔導:會計電算化常用術語(二)

【會計從業會計證輔導:會計電算化常用術語二】相關文章: